What Is Parallels Desktop — A Simplified Overview

If you’ve ever wished to run Windows (or other operating systems) directly on your Mac — without rebooting or juggling between devices — then Parallels Desktop might just be what you’re looking for. At its heart, Parallels is a virtualization software that creates a “guest” operating environment inside your existing macOS system. That means you can launch Windows, Linux or other OSes within a window (or full‑screen), and use them side‑by‑side with your regular Mac applications.

In practice, this effectively turns your Mac into a dual‑system machine, delivering many of the benefits of having both a Mac and a Windows PC — without needing two separate devices. It's a bridge between two computing worlds, offering flexibility to users who need tools from both ecosystems.



Why Many People Turn to Parallels: Key Benefits

  • Unified workflow: Instead of switching devices or rebooting to use Windows apps, you can run them right alongside macOS tools. This is especially helpful for users who rely on software only available on Windows (e.g. certain business tools, specialised applications, or games).
  • Broad OS support: You’re not limited to Windows — Parallels supports Linux and (in some cases) older OSes, giving you flexibility if you want to experiment or run niche software.
  • User‑friendly setup: Installing a guest OS is usually straightforward, even for users who aren’t power‑users. Parallels handles the virtual machine creation and setup, lowering the technical barrier significantly.
  • Cross‑OS integration: It’s not just about running two systems — you really get smooth interoperability: drag‑and‑drop between OSes, shared clipboard, file transfer, and other integrations that make the VM feel like a native extension rather than a separate machine.
  • Efficiency for many tasks: For tasks like office software, web browsing, or light Windows applications, the performance overhead is often minimal — especially on modern Mac hardware.


What Could Be Better — Understanding the Trade‑offs

But like any virtualization tool, Parallels isn’t perfect. It comes with trade‑offs that are worth knowing before deciding:

  • It’s not free: Parallels is a commercial product, so there’s a cost associated — typically via a subscription or license fee. For users who only occasionally need Windows, this could feel expensive.
  • Performance depends on hardware & workload: Running a guest OS eats up CPU, RAM, and storage. On lighter tasks it’s often fine — but heavy workloads (e.g. gaming, large data processing, video editing) might suffer compared to native hardware.
  • Occasional glitches: Some users report instability, bugs or resource‑usage issues. Virtualization abstracts hardware, which can lead to unexpected behavior depending on the host and guest system configuration.
  • Not ideal for all use cases: If you need maximum performance — for high‑end games or CPU/GPU‑intensive software — virtualization may not deliver the same experience as a real Windows PC.


When Does Parallels Make the Most Sense? Ideal Use Cases

Parallels Desktop tends to shine in particular scenarios, including:

  • Office / productivity workflows — using Windows‑only applications (e.g. specific business software, legacy Windows tools) while relying primarily on macOS.
  • Cross‑platform development or testing — developers needing to test software on multiple OSes without switching machines.
  • Casual Windows gaming or older Windows apps — when native Windows hardware isn’t available or not ideal.
  • Users who value convenience and flexibility over raw performance — those willing to trade a bit of overhead for a seamless multi‑OS workflow.

If you rarely use Windows — or can rely on cloud/online tools — the benefit of virtualization might not outweigh the cost or complexity.



Who Should Consider Alternatives — And What Are They?

For some users, especially those with specific requirements (maximum performance, zero overhead, free tools), Parallels may not be the ideal fit. In such cases, alternatives to consider include:

  • Free virtualization software — if cost is a concern and performance demands are modest.
  • Dual-boot or native installation — when performance and resource allocation are priorities, installing Windows directly (or using a dedicated PC) remains a strong option.
  • Cloud-based solutions or remote desktops — for occasional Windows access without local resource burden.

Each solution carries its own trade‑offs: free tools often lack polish and integration, dual‑boot requires rebooting, and remote solutions depend heavily on connection quality.
